Also more reports from today emerged. The explosions are reported all over the Kherson Oblast in the right bank of Dnepr. There are also reports of simultaneous local counteroffensive in Zaporizhia Oblast, where some villages might have been liberated as well, and a lot of explosions also happening in Melitopol, with partisan doing their job. Russians fled/abandoned the military hospital in Melitopol among the expolsions and attacks. Biggest success so far near Inhulets bridgehead, 3 villages liberated for now, but the situation is still considered fluid and this might change during the night. Another reported big success is in the north of Kherson Oblast, where one of the main Russian fortifications in the town of Arkhangelske allegedly fallen, and it is rumoured, that this town was liberated as well. This one is for me a little bit to good to be true news, so we’ll see in day or two. Also small village of Zolota Balka in northern Kherson close to Dnepr might have been liberated as well.

  17. More about economics of war. Russia has launched approximately 7.5 billion USD worth of missiles since the beginning of the war. The used up almost all of the Iskander missiles, and are probably slowly running out of Kalibr (they still have pretty big stockpile). That is the main reason, why they are using modified S300 rockets more and more often. They are launching them already in three occupied Oblasts. (Kherson, Zaporhizhia, Kharkiv)
